How to Transfer QuickBooks to a New Computer (Step-by-Step)

Follow these steps carefully to ensure a smooth transition:

Step 1: Prepare Your Old Computer
  • Open QuickBooks and log in as Admin
  • Update QuickBooks to the latest version
  • Back up your company file (File > Back Up Company)

This ensures your data is safe before you begin.

Step 2: Install QuickBooks on the New Computer
  • Download the correct QuickBooks version
  • Use your license and product number
  • Complete the installation process

Step 3: Transfer Your Backup File
  • Copy your backup file (.QBB) using a USB or secure cloud storage
  • Move it to the new computer

Make sure the transfer is complete—partial files can cause errors.

Step 4: Restore the Company File
  • Open QuickBooks on the new system
  • Click File > Open or Restore Company
  • Select "Restore a backup copy"
  • Choose your file and complete the process
Step 5: Verify Data Accuracy
  • Check reports, balances, and transactions
  • Ensure nothing is missing or corrupted

Advanced Troubleshooting for Transfer Issues

If basic steps don't work, try these advanced fixes:

Use QuickBooks Tool Hub

The QuickBooks Tool Hub is a powerful utility that helps fix common errors.

  • Download and install QuickBooks Tool Hub
  • Open it and go to "Company File Issues"
  • Run QuickBooks File Doctor

This tool can repair damaged files and resolve access errors.

Fix QuickBooks Error 6190

This error usually happens when multiple users try to access a file incorrectly.

  • Make sure all users are logged out
  • Restart your system
  • Open the file again in single-user mode

Repair QuickBooks Installation
  • Go to Control Panel > Programs
  • Select QuickBooks and click "Repair"
  • Restart your computer

This helps fix installation-related issues.

Check File Permissions
  • Right-click your company file
  • Go to Properties > Security
  • Ensure full access permissions are enabled

1. How do I transfer QuickBooks to a new computer without losing data?
You should create a full backup (.QBB file) from your old computer and restore it on the new one. This ensures all financial data, reports, and settings transfer safely.

2. Do I need to reinstall QuickBooks on the new computer?
Yes, you must install QuickBooks using your original license and product key before restoring your company file.

3. Can I transfer QuickBooks using a USB drive?
Yes, using a USB drive is one of the easiest ways to move your backup file securely to the new computer.
